Thursday's Game Notes
CINCINNATI - The Xavier University women's basketball team is set to take on Fordham on Thursday, February 22. Game time is set for 12 p.m. at Cintas Center and the contest will mark XU's third-annual Youth Day. Xavier comes into the game with a 21-7 overall record and a 9-3 mark in Atlantic 10 play. The Rams enter Thursday's contest at 3-21, 1-11.
The Series vs. the Fordham
The Musketeers are 13-2 all-time vs. Fordham and have won the last 11 meetings between the two sides. Xavier's last loss to the Rams came on January 25, 1997, a 60-55 setback at Schmidt Fieldhouse. XU is 6-1 all-time vs. the Rams in Cincinnati, including 3-0 at Cintas Center.
McGuff Gets 100
Fifth-year head coach Kevin McGuff's first four seasons at Xavier have been the most productive first four seasons any XU coach has enjoyed. McGuff is the first coach to lead Xavier to four consecutive postseason appearances in his/her first four years at XU and the 80 wins accumulated in his first four years are the most by any XU coach. McGuff's record at Xavier now stands at 101-49 (.673).
20 Win Notes
Xavier won its 20th game of the season on 2/15 at Richmond, marking the 10th time the Musketeers have reached the 20-win plateau. The win was also XU's third consecutive 20-win season, marked the second straight year Xavier has won 20 regular season games and marked the fourth time in five years that Kevin McGuff has recorded 20 wins. Xavier has won at least 20 games in seven of the last nine years. XU has a chance to tie the 1999-00 team for the second-most regular season wins in program history with 23.

Harris Shatters Blocks Record
Freshman standout Amber Harris established a new single-season blocked shots record at Xavier when she recorded her 40th block of the season vs. Eastern Illinois on December 15 at the 14:22 mark of the second half. Harris has since extended that record to 113 blocks and she is on pace to block 121 shots this season. Taru Tuukkanen blocked 39 shots during the 2000-01 season to set the previous mark. Harris is third in the country at 4.0 blocks per game. The NCAA record for blocked shots by a freshman is 119, set by Oklahoma's Courtney Paris last season.

Xavier's Newest Additions to the 1,000-Point Club
Senior guard Suntana Granderson notched her 1,000th career point vs. Saint Joe's on February 24, 2006 and currently sits in 10th place on the all-time list. She is 47 points shy of Stacey Land's ninth-place mark. Senior Miranda Green recorded her 1,000th career point vs. St. Bonaventure on January 28, 2007 and currently sits in 17th place on the all-time list. She is 45 points shy of Jenny Rauh's 16th-place mark. Senior Michele Miller is also within striking distance of the 1,000 point mark, 135 short of the plateau.
